I know that taking your pill "on time" means within 2 hours, but is there ANY increased risk of pregnancy from taking your pill 1 hour later than usual? My fiance and I had SI Friday and Sunday, and I took my pill 1 hour later than usual on Saturday. We also used a spermicidal lubricant both days (thanks for the suggestions on that post, by the way). Maybe I just need peace of mind...I think every woman goes through worries and doubts especially when trying new birth control (I have always used condoms before.) Anyhow, thanks for any comments.


No, there is no additional risk in taking your pill 1 hour later than your regular pill time. If you have been taking your pills correctly, no vomiting or diarrhea within 2 hours after taking your pill and not taking meds or supplements that would reduce your pills effectiveness then you should be well protected.
